    Did you know? Roughly 22.7 percent of adults had doctor-diagnosed arthritis in 2013-2015, with 43.5 percent of those individuals having limitations in their usual activities due to the arthritis (Centers for Disease Control and Prevention).     According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, roughly 43 percent of individuals that are hospitalized after a traumatic brain injury (TBI) have a related disability the following year.
